The Benefits Of Water Window Cleaning

When it comes to keeping your windows sparkling clean, there are various methods available. One popular and effective technique is water window cleaning. This method involves using water as the main cleaning agent to achieve streak-free and crystal-clear windows. The process of water window cleaning typically involves using purified water that is free from any contaminants or minerals that could potentially leave streaks or residue on the glass.

One of the main benefits of water window cleaning is its eco-friendliness. Unlike traditional window cleaning methods that involve the use of harsh chemicals, water window cleaning is a more sustainable and environmentally friendly option. By using purified water as the main cleaning agent, you can avoid the use of harmful chemicals that can be damaging to the environment and your health. This makes water window cleaning a great choice for those who are looking to reduce their carbon footprint and adopt more eco-friendly cleaning practices.

Another advantage of water window cleaning is its effectiveness in achieving a streak-free finish. Because purified water does not contain any minerals or contaminants that can leave streaks on the glass, you can achieve crystal-clear windows without having to worry about unsightly streaks or residue. This makes water window cleaning an ideal option for achieving professional-looking results without the need for har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.

Additionally, water window cleaning is a time-saving method that can help you achieve sparkling clean windows in a fraction of the time compared to traditional cleaning methods. The purified water used in water window cleaning allows for a quicker and more efficient cleaning process, as it effectively breaks down dirt and grime on the glass surface without the need for excessive scrubbing or drying. This can be particularly beneficial for those with larger windows or multiple windows to clean, as it can help streamline the cleaning process and save you time and effort.

Furthermore, water window cleaning is a safer option for both you and your windows. Traditional window cleaning methods often involve the use of ladders or scaffolding to reach higher windows, which can pose a safety risk for both the cleaner and the windows themselves. With water window cleaning, the use of purified water and specialized equipment allows for cleaning windows from the ground level, eliminating the need for ladders or scaffolding. This not only reduces the risk of accidents or injuries but also helps prevent damage to your windows from the use of abrasive tools or harsh chemicals.

In addition to its eco-friendliness, effectiveness, time-saving benefits, and safety considerations, water window cleaning also offers long-lasting results. Because purified water does not leave behind any residue or streaks on the glass, your windows will stay cleaner for longer periods of time. This can help extend the time between cleanings and keep your windows looking their best for longer.
